
Curaleaf Reports on Voting Results from the 2025 Annual General Meeting of Shareholders
The total number of votes cast by the shareholders in person or represented by proxy at the Meeting was 1,722,745,691 votes (with each subordinate voting share entitling the holder thereof to one (1) vote, and each multiple voting share entitling the holder thereof to fifteen (15) votes). The voting results in relation to the election of directors were as follows:
In addition, the number of directors of the Company was also set by the shareholders of Curaleaf at ten (10) directors, and the resolution with respect to the reappointment of PKF O'Connor Davies, LLP as the Company's auditor put before the shareholders for consideration and approval at the Meeting, as described in the Circular, was duly approved by the requisite number of votes. The Company has filed a report of voting results on all resolutions voted on at the Meeting under its profile on www.sedarplus.ca and on www.sec.gov/edgar.
About Curaleaf Holdings
Curaleaf Holdings, Inc. (TSX: CURA) (OTCQX: CURLF) ("Curaleaf") is a leading international provider of consumer products in cannabis with a mission to enhance lives by cultivating, sharing and celebrating the power of the plant. As a high-growth cannabis company known for quality, expertise and reliability, the Company and its brands, including Curaleaf, Select, Grassroots, Find, Anthem and The Hemp Company provide industry-leading service, product selection and accessibility across the medical and adult use markets. Curaleaf International is powered by a strong presence in all stages of the supply chain. Its unique distribution network throughout Europe, Canada and Australasia brings together pioneering science and research with cutting-edge cultivation, extraction and production. Curaleaf is list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ange under the symbol CURA and trades on the OTCQX market under the symbol CURLF. For more information, please visit https://ir.curaleaf.com.

Max Power Closes First $2.45 Million in Private Placements With Eric Sprott as Lead Investor
VANCOUVER, British Columbia, Aug. 01,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— MAX Power Mining Corp. (CSE: MAXX; OTC: MAXXF; FRANKFURT: 89N) ('MAX Power' or the 'Company') announces that further to its news releases of July 15 and July 23, 2025, the Company has closed non-brokered private placements of Units (the 'Offerings') for total gross proceeds of C$2,450,000 with Eric Sprott as lead investor. Pursuant to the closing of the Offerings, the Company has issued 5,681,818 Units at $0.22 comprising 5,618,818 common shares and 5,681,818 share purchase warrants exercisable at a price of C$0.29 per warrant share, and a total of 7,500,000 Units at $0.16 comprising of a total of 7,500,000 common shares and 7,500,000 share purchase warrants exercisable at a price of C$0.25 per warrant share. The warrants shall be exercisable until August 1, 2027, and are subject to an acceleration clause.
